The Two-Exam Path to Certification
If you are confident in your background, the next step is to conquer the two required exams: the Microsoft Azure Architect Technologies (AZ-303) and the Microsoft Azure Architect Design (AZ-304). These exams validate your skills across a wide range of advanced topics.

Choosing Your Ideal Preparation Method
Given the breadth of the curriculum, it’s common for candidates to have gaps in their knowledge. Fortunately, there are structured ways to prepare. You can opt for Microsoft’s free online training materials available at their official site: https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/learn/certifications/azure-solutions-architect. This path requires significant self-discipline and dedicated personal time.
